The Study of Socialization Factors which have Influenced to the Public Mind of Muban Chombueng Rajabhat University Students

Abstract

In this study, the researcher had the objectives which are 1) To investigate socialization factors which have influenced the public mind of the student. 2) To study the relationship between socialization factors and public mind of the student and 3) To find a predictative equation of the public mind of the students from socialization. The research population consisted of 400 undergraduate students at Muban Chombueng Rajabhat
University. The researcher analyzed the data collection in terms of frequency, percentage, average, arithmetic mean, standard deviation, Pearson’s product moment correlation coefficient technique and multiple regression. All the test statistics are statistically significant
at the .05 level. The results could be summarized as follows: 

1. The students’ overall level of socialization and the public mind are at the high level. 2. For the investigation of the relationship between socialization and public mind of the Students at Muban Chombueng Rajabhat University, the researcher found that socialization at school (X2) and the public mind (y) showed the highest correlation coefficient at .525. Secondly, socialization through peer groups (X3) and public mind (y), displayed a correlation coefficient of .431. Thirdly, socialization in the family(X1) and public mind(y), evinced a correlation coefficient of .387. Lastly, socialization through the mass media (X4)and public mind (y) manifested a correlation coefficient of .358. All of these correlations were at the statistically significant level of .01 3. Socialization at school (X2), socialization through peer groups (X3) and socialization through the mass media (X4) could be used as predictor variables for student public mind. Accordingly, these variables allow for the framing of a predictive equation as follows: gif.latex?\inline&space;\hat{Y}=21.579&space;+&space;.588(x_{2})+.297(x_{3})+.2146(x_{4})
